Delray Beach, FL Local Guide

Cheapest Neighborhoods for Apartments in Delray Beach, FL

Pricing Updated: 05/01/2026

Current apartment rentals in the Delray Beach, FL area range in price from $1,489 to $7,000 with an overall median price of $3,513. The three Delray Beach neighborhoods with the lowest median rent pricing are Villages of Oriole at $2,015, Gleneagles at $2,083, and Huntington Pointe at $1,900. Frequently Asked Questions about Delray Beach

What type of rentals are currently available in Delray Beach?

There are currently 445 Apartments for Rent in Delray Beach,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,489 to $7,000. There are also 809 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Delray Beach ranging from $1,200 to $60,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Delray Beach?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Delray Beach ranges from $1,200 to $60,000 with an average monthly rent of $9,879.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Delray Beach?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Delray Beach range from $2,250 to $6,252,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,000 to $25,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,000 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$4,495.
